Contrasting with Traditional Casino Environments
Spending time on MegaBlock is completely different from being in a physical UK casino. On the high street, you face constant interruptions. You need to get a drink. You must walk to the cashier. Someone may talk to you. They might not have clocks, but you still have a body that gets tired or thirsty. These are physical realities that break up play. MegaBlock’s digital world eliminates all those natural breaks away. There’s no last call, no sore feet, no chatty stranger at the next machine. The immersion is absolute. The environment is meticulously controlled to stay the same, a steady atmosphere crafted for long sessions. A real building made of bricks and mortar can not ever manage that.

A Design Approach Centered on Involvement
Scratch the surface and you find a design built to reduce friction and keep your screen on https://megablock-casino.eu/. The interface is strikingly minimalist. Deposit buttons are clearly visible, whereas withdrawal options are not emphasized. Games appear in a flash, removing any downtime that might cause you to reflect on stopping. Then there’s ’state preservation‘. Shut the app on your phone during a game, and when you open it again, you are placed exactly where you left off. This makes it simple to convince yourself you’ll come back for „only a second,“ which regularly becomes an hour. The colours are bright but gentle on the eyes during prolonged use. Everything, from the vibration of your phone to the timing of a bonus round, seems calibrated to produce a single, seamless, continuous gaming experience.
Tools for Responsible Gambling and Their Practical Use
Understanding the game’s appeal, MegaBlock Casino Game, like every operator licensed by the UKGC, must provide responsible gaming tools. I reviewed these features carefully. You can establish deposit limits, playtime reminders, and take a ‚time-out‘ for days or weeks. How they get used is another matter. The tools are available, but they are hidden in the account settings. As they are voluntary, players who are deeply engaged often overlook them. The session reminder pop-up plays a key role, but I’ve seen it become just another button to dismiss mindlessly, a tiny speed bump in the game. These tools only work if a player decides to turn them on *before* they commence play. That requirement of advance planning contradicts the platform’s simple, spur-of-the-moment entry.
Managing the Flow State Securely
So how can a person in the UK play MegaBlock without wasting the whole evening? From what I’ve noticed, the best defence is an external one. Since the game is designed to block out the world, you have to draw the world back in. A kitchen timer or an alarm on a separate device works much more effectively than any in-game alert. More crucial is setting a strict ritual before you begin. Set a money limit and a time limit. Write them down on paper. Put the cash you’re ready to lose in a separate account first. The key is to make these choices in the full light of day, not in the hypnotic glow of the screen. Think of a gaming session as a planned event with a firm finish, like attending a movie. That can change it from a mindless habit into something you actually choose to do.
